In this insightful episode of Mental Health News Radio, host Kristen Sinanta-Walker welcomes Dr. John Huber, a distinguished clinical forensic psychologist, to discuss the future of mental health becoming mainstream. Dr. Huber shares his extensive experience in the field, which began as a school psychologist dealing with severe issues among students. His passion for helping led him to the courtroom, where he realized the importance of furthering his education to better support those in need. Dr.

Huber's journey took him from academia, teaching at Texas State University, to private practice. His innovative approach includes integrating martial arts into mental health practices, leveraging physical activity to enhance focus and emotional well-being. He emphasizes the importance of being grounded and the positive impact it has on relationships and personal health. A significant part of Dr. Huber's work involves providing mental health support in hospitals lacking such resources.

He describes the unique challenges of working with patients in acute care settings, highlighting the need for adaptability and empathy in therapy sessions. His efforts have been instrumental in bridging the gap between physical and mental health care. As the public face of Mainstream Mental Health, Dr. Huber advocates for making mental health discussions part of everyday conversations. His podcast, hosted on the MHNR Network, aims to educate and support listeners by addressing diverse mental health topics.
